You can test new tech ideas using the Seinfeld Test

Would the product eliminate the plot of an episode? (Google maps, cell phones, paypal, battery packs)

Good tech.

Would the product inspire new Seinfeld plots? (NFTs, AI chatbots, crypto currency, blindboxes, metaverse land sales)

Bad tech.

The Venn overlap of people who insist Hallowe'en isn't British and people who insist 'soccer' isn't British is probably close to a circle. They're all wrong.

For a kid in 70s Wales, it was huge. Carving turnip lanterns (no pumpkins available), apple bobbing etc. And we didn't learn it from America.
